#70f39c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#70f39c is composed of 43.9% red, 95.3% green and 61.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 35.8% yellow and 4.7% black. It has a hue angle of 140.2 degrees, a saturation of 84.5% and a lightness of 69.6%. #70f39c color hex could be obtained by blending #e0ffff with #00e739. Closest websafe color is: #66ff99.

#70f39c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#70f39c has RGB values of R:112, G:243, B:156 and CMYK values of C:0.54, M:0, Y:0.36,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 7402396.

Shades and Tints of #70f39c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000201 is the darkest color, while #effef4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#70f39c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#acb7b0 is the less saturated color, while #64ff98 is the most saturated one.
